Original warning text
1. DISTRESS SIGNAL RECEIVED ON 121.5 MHZ IN 26-09N 170-53E AT 022156Z NOV.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O RCC HONOLULU, TELEX: 392401, PHONE: 808 541 2500, FAX: 808 541 2123. 2. CANCEL HYDROPAC 1905/03, SIGNAL CEASED.
